Creative Patio Flooring Options

Changing your outdoor space with stylish flooring doesn’t have to be expensive. Let’s explore some creative patio flooring options that are both budget-friendly and beautiful.

Concrete Pavers

Concrete pavers are a versatile and affordable choice for your patio. They can be arranged in various patterns and colors, offering a custom look without the high cost. Concrete is durable and requires minimal maintenance, making it perfect for busy homeowners. Consider using stamped concrete if you want a textured appearance that mimics more expensive materials like stone or tile.

Gravel

Gravel is one of the most cost-effective materials for patio flooring. It’s easy to install and provides excellent drainage, which is ideal for areas prone to heavy rain. Gravel comes in different colors and sizes, allowing you to customize the look of your patio. Plus, its rustic charm adds a natural touch to your outdoor space. To keep weeds at bay, lay down landscaping fabric before spreading the gravel.

Gravel is an affordable and easy-to-install patio flooring option, perfect for those on a budget. - backyard patio design ideas on a budget infographic checklist-light-beige

Reclaimed Materials

Using reclaimed materials not only saves money but also adds unique character to your patio. You can source old bricks, stones, or wood from salvage yards or renovation sites. This eco-friendly option reduces waste and gives your patio a story. Imagine a patio with a mix of antique bricks and weathered wood, each piece with its own history. Reclaimed materials are not only economical but also create a one-of-a-kind look.

By choosing these creative patio flooring options, you can achieve a stunning outdoor space without overspending. Whether you prefer the sleek look of concrete, the natural appeal of gravel, or the charm of reclaimed materials, there’s a budget-friendly solution for everyone.

DIY Furniture and Decor Ideas

Creating a stylish and comfortable patio doesn’t require spending a fortune. By embracing DIY projects, you can personalize your space while staying within budget. Let’s explore some DIY furniture and decor ideas that will transform your patio into a welcoming retreat.

Pallet Furniture

Pallets are a DIY enthusiast’s best friend. They’re affordable, versatile, and can be transformed into almost any furniture piece. Consider building a simple pallet sofa or coffee table. Just sand the pallets, paint them in your favorite color, and add some cushions. You can even stack pallets to create a bar or a raised garden bed. Pallet furniture is not only budget-friendly but also adds a rustic charm to your patio.

Upcycled Decor

Upcycling is all about turning old items into something new and beautiful. Search your home or local thrift stores for items that can be repurposed for your patio. An old ladder can become a plant stand, or a vintage suitcase can be transformed into a unique side table. The possibilities are endless, and upcycled decor adds a personal touch to your outdoor space. Plus, it’s a sustainable choice that helps reduce waste.

Outdoor Rugs

An outdoor rug is an easy way to add color and comfort to your patio. These rugs are designed to withstand the elements, making them a practical choice for any outdoor area. Choose a pattern that complements your patio furniture and decor. Rugs help define spaces and make your patio feel like an extension of your home. They’re also great for covering up any unsightly spots on your patio floor.

String Lights

String lights create a magical ambiance in any outdoor space. They’re affordable and easy to install, making them a popular choice for DIY enthusiasts. Drape them across your patio, wrap them around trees, or hang them along a fence. String lights add a soft, inviting glow that’s perfect for evening gatherings. Consider using solar-powered string lights for an eco-friendly option that saves on energy costs.

By incorporating these DIY furniture and decor ideas, you can create a patio that reflects your style without breaking the bank. Whether it’s the rustic appeal of pallet furniture or the cozy glow of string lights, these projects will improve your outdoor space and make it uniquely yours.

Adding Greenery and Natural Elements

Incorporating greenery into your patio design is a simple and effective way to bring life and vibrancy to your outdoor space. Let’s explore some backyard patio design ideas on a budget that focus on adding natural elements.

Raised Herb Garden

A raised herb garden is an excellent choice for those who love fresh flavors and want to keep gardening simple. You can build a raised bed using inexpensive materials like wood or even repurposed pallets. Fill it with soil and plant your favorite herbs such as basil, mint, or rosemary. Raised gardens are not only practical but also add a touch of greenery to your patio. Plus, having fresh herbs on hand can lift your culinary creations.

Flower Beds

Flower beds can transform a plain patio into a colorful oasis. Opt for a mix of annuals and perennials to ensure your garden stays vibrant throughout the seasons. Consider planting flowers like coneflowers or black-eyed Susans for a splash of color. If you’re looking to save money, start with seeds or young plants. Flower beds are a fantastic way to add texture and interest to your patio without a significant investment.

Vertical Garden

When space is limited, vertical gardens are a perfect solution. They allow you to grow plants upwards, saving valuable floor space. Use wall-mounted planters or hanging baskets to cultivate climbing plants such as ivy or jasmine. Vertical gardens not only improve the visual appeal of your patio but also create a sense of privacy. They’re a stylish way to introduce more greenery, especially in small or urban spaces.

By integrating these elements, you can create a lush, inviting atmosphere on your patio. Whether it’s the practicality of a raised herb garden or the vibrant colors of flower beds, adding natural elements is a budget-friendly way to improve your outdoor space.

Enhancing Ambiance with Lighting

Lighting is a simple yet powerful way to transform your patio into a cozy retreat. The right lighting can make your outdoor space feel magical, inviting, and safe. Let’s explore some backyard patio design ideas on a budget focusing on lighting.

Outdoor Lighting

Outdoor lighting is key to extending the use of your patio beyond daylight hours. It creates a warm and welcoming atmosphere. Consider using low-voltage landscape lights to highlight pathways and important features like trees or garden beds. These lights are energy-efficient and easy to install.

String Lights

String lights are a popular choice for adding a fairy-tale-like glow to your patio. They are affordable and easy to hang from trees, pergolas, or along fences. According to Melanie Jade Design, string lights are perfect for creating a dreamy atmosphere. They work well for evening gatherings, adding a touch of magic to any outdoor space.

Solar-Powered Lanterns

Solar-powered lanterns are both eco-friendly and cost-effective. They charge during the day and provide soft lighting at night. Place them on tables or hang them from hooks for a charming effect. These lanterns are especially useful in areas without electrical access, making them a versatile option for any patio.

By incorporating these lighting ideas, you can create a patio that’s both functional and enchanting. Whether you’re hosting a dinner party or enjoying a quiet evening, the right lighting will improve your outdoor experience.

Backyard Patio Design Ideas on a Budget

Designing a patio doesn’t have to be costly. With a few smart choices, you can create a beautiful and functional outdoor space without breaking the bank. Here are some backyard patio design ideas on a budget that focus on using concrete, maximizing small spaces, and opting for low-maintenance designs.

Concrete Patio

Concrete is a practical and budget-friendly choice for patio flooring. It’s durable, easy to maintain, and can be customized. You can stamp or stain concrete to mimic more expensive materials like stone or tile. This gives you a high-end look for much less.

One idea is to create a simple rectangular concrete patio. This shape is not only efficient to install but also offers a clean, modern look. Add interest by painting a unique design on the concrete floor. This is an affordable way to add personality to your patio.

Small Patio Ideas

If you have limited space, don’t worry. Small patios can be just as charming as larger ones. Style a narrow balcony by adding a bistro table and a couple of chairs. This creates a cozy spot for morning coffee or evening chats.

Another idea is to use vertical gardening to maximize space. Hang planters on walls or use a trellis for climbing plants. This not only adds greenery but also creates a more intimate and lush atmosphere.

Low-Maintenance Design

For those who prefer a hassle-free patio, consider a low-maintenance design. Opt for materials that require little upkeep, like gravel or concrete pavers. Gravel is especially easy to install and allows for good drainage.

Choose furniture made from weather-resistant materials like treated wood or all-weather wicker. These options stand up well to the elements and require minimal care.

Additionally, incorporate multi-functional furniture. Pieces like storage benches or foldable tables save space and add functionality. This approach keeps your patio tidy and easy to manage.

By using these budget-friendly ideas, you can create a patio that is stylish, functional, and easy to maintain. Whether you’re working with a small space or looking for low-maintenance options, these tips will help you design a patio that suits your needs and budget.

Frequently Asked Questions about Budget Patio Design

What is the cheapest type of patio to build?

The most affordable patio option is gravel. It’s easy to install and perfect for those looking to save money. Gravel allows for excellent drainage, making it great for rainy areas.

Concrete is another cost-effective choice. Although it requires more prep work than gravel, it’s durable and low-maintenance. You can even customize concrete with stamping or staining for a more upscale appearance.

Using reclaimed materials is a creative way to save money. Look for leftover bricks, stones, or pavers from construction sites or online marketplaces. These materials not only reduce costs but also add unique character to your patio.

How to make a patio look nice on a budget?

To improve your patio without spending much, start with paint. Painting concrete or wooden surfaces can refresh and brighten your space instantly.

Incorporate DIY decor like homemade planters or pallet furniture. These projects are fun and give your patio a personal touch.

Strategic furniture placement is key. Arrange seating to create cozy conversation areas, and use outdoor rugs to define spaces. This makes the patio inviting without needing expensive decor.

What is the cheapest way to do a patio area?

Begin with concrete pavers or gravel for the base. Both are affordable and easy to lay down yourself. Concrete pavers offer a neat, uniform look, while gravel provides a more rustic feel.

Consider DIY projects to cut costs further. Build your own furniture using pallets or repurpose old items from your home. This adds charm and function without breaking the bank.

By focusing on these budget-friendly strategies, you can create a beautiful and inviting patio that won’t strain your finances.
